How they compare
Spain currently reports 105.49 million current US$ against 0 current US$ in Türkiye, a difference of 105.49 million current US$.
The two have swapped places 5 times across 10 shared years of data; in 2005 it was Spain ahead.
Spain ranks 18th and Türkiye ranks 21st of 26 countries.
Spain has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Spain | Türkiye |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 315.99 million current US$ | 113.11 million current US$ | 202.88 million current US$ | Spain |
| 2010s | 96.36 million current US$ | 74.35 million current US$ | 22.02 million current US$ | Spain |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
